    General Standards, personnel, design 1.4.5 Chimney connection/chimney system EN 303-5 specifies that the entire flue gas system must be designed to prevent, wherever possible, damage caused by seepage, insufficient feed pressure and condensation. It should be noted here that flue gas temperatures of less than 160 K above room temperature can occur within the permitted operating range of the boiler.

    The ratio of the radius of curvature (r) to pipe diameter (d) should be greater than 1: r:d ≥ 1 For example P4 Pellet 8/15: - Diameter of supply air connection = 80 mm - Minimum radius of pipe bends = 80 mm Install the supply air line in as straight a line as possible and over the shortest path.

    Installation Install discharge system Potential Equalisation When connecting the hose lines to the individual connection pipes, ensure there is potential equalization throughout the line! Expose approximately 3 cm of the grounding strap on the end of the hose line TIP: Slit the insulation open along the wire with a knife Bend the earth wire inwards in a loop This prevents the earth wire from being damaged by the feed of pellets.

    Installation Install discharge system Sloping floor Fig.1: Store for a discharge unit with a suction probe Fig.2: Store for a discharge unit with a screw The under-floor structure should be dimensioned so that the sloping floor is not deformed when subjected to static load. You should ensure that the pellets can slide down smoothly.
